Wara [ˈvara]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Nozdrzec, within Brzozów County, Subcarpathian Voivodeship, in south-eastern Poland. It lies approximately 3 kilometres (2 mi) south-east of Nozdrzec, 17 km (11 mi) north-east of Brzozów, and 34 km (21 mi) south-east of the regional capital Rzeszów.[1]
